Running Ranch, Arlington Neighborhood

Running Ranch features an array of primarily single detached homes, with many residences built during the 1980s through the early 2000s. This neighborhood offers a substantial number of properties with four or more bedrooms, accommodating spacious living arrangements. Convenient access to both primary and secondary schools is available from many houses here. The area benefits from a network of well-maintained streets designed for comfortable car travel, making parking quite accessible. Nearby neighborhoods provide a variety of public green spaces that are easily reachable, contributing to a peaceful atmosphere throughout the community. Overall, this neighborhood presents a quiet and spacious residential setting.

There are a lot of green spaces to enjoy in Running Ranch. Public green spaces are especially well-located and there are a few of them nearby for residents to visit, which makes it easy to access them. Lastly, as there are very few pedestrians, this part of the city remains relatively quiet.

🏫 Carol Holt Elementary School

A well-regarded public school serving grades K–4, Carol Holt Elementary is located just north of Running Ranch and anchors the neighborhood with strong academic performance and community involvement, making it a standout local institution.

🏞️ Lana Wolff Linear Park Trail

This 12‑acre linear green space bordering Collins Street, just east of Running Ranch, promises a new 12‑foot‑wide, quarter‑mile trail along Johnson Creek for walking, jogging, and biking, offering future direct recreational access for neighbors.

🤝 Cliff Nelson Recreation Center & Pond

Located a short walk from Running Ranch, this community recreation facility features a fishing pond and hosts seasonal youth camps and events, creating a convenient and family‑friendly gathering spot popular with residents.

🍽️ Nearby Grocery & Café Strip on Cooper Street

Just minutes from Running Ranch, the stretch along Cooper Street hosts an array of grocery stores, cafes, and casual eateries, providing easy access to daily essentials and local dining options for the neighborhood.

🚶 Sidewalk‑Friendly Residential Streets

Well‑lit, pedestrian‑friendly streets with sidewalks throughout Running Ranch encourage safe walking, jogging, and neighborly strolls within the community, praised by residents as fostering a peaceful, friendly and connected atmosphere.
